Transaction 7edb59b2a5fe281869635470854794793980d49517c32c91f8108bf0194de8da

37 Input
2 Outputs
  • 7edb59b2a5fe281869635470854794793980d49517c32c91f8108bf0194de8da:0
  • value  9764025
    address  15gYo4s1KhuxbZi22dRKfFebHZYD1dCTJv
  • 7edb59b2a5fe281869635470854794793980d49517c32c91f8108bf0194de8da:1
  • value  10800000
    address  1J4g44xrXGxzpsJJGKhS6hs2672twoshRG